Eww. Why not just use an entirely different struct for TDX? I don't see what
benefit this provides other than a warm fuzzy feeling that TDX and SEV share a
struct. Practically speaking, KVM will likely take on more work to forcefully
smush the two together than if they're separate things.

generalizing the struct of KVM_MEM_ENC_OP should be the first step. The final target should be generalizing a set of commands for confidential VMs (SEV-* VMs and TDs, maybe even for other arches), e.g., the commands to create a confidential VM and commands to live migration a confidential VM.

However, there seems not small divergence between the commands to create a SEV-* VM and TDX VMs. I'm not sure if it is worth investigating and pursuing.
